Caterpillar Aftermarket Seat & Mechanical Suspension For Skid Steers

*If You Purchase The Replacement Backrest Kit (PN: 8466), You Will Lose The Ability To Have Lumbar Support And A Backrest Extension Kit, Unless You Cut Those Parts Out Of Your Old Backrest Kit*

*This Seat & Mechanical Suspension In Black Vinyl (PN: 7882) Now Comes Standard With An Operator Presence Switch And Retractable Seat Belt.*

*Please Verify All Measurements And Model Numbers (The WHOLE Model Number). In Some Cases, Particular Machines Have Multiple Options. It Is Up To You To Decide For Sure If This Item Fits Your Machine. If You Need Help, Please Call Or Email Us.*

Features:

  • Grammer Air MSG75/531 Seat (PNs: 7916, 7776 & 8189) OR Grammer Mechancial MSG65/531 Seat (PNs: 7882, 8188 & 8462)
  • Durable fabric or vinyl covering
  • Low-profile air suspension with 12-Volt compressor with suspension travel of 3.1" (standard on PNs: 7916, 7776 & 8189)
  • Mechanical suspension with suspension travel of 2.38" (standard on PNs: 7882, 8188 & 8462)
  • Vacuum formed narrow seat cushion of 18.5"
  • Asymmetrical backrest shape to make driving backwards more comfortable
  • Adjustable backrest adds comfort and versatility
  • Mechanical lumbar support to help prevent lower back pain
  • Retractable seat belt for added safety (standard on PNs: 7882, 7916 & 8189) (optional on PNs: 7776, 8188 & 8462)
  • Shock absorber (standard on PNs: 7916, 7776 & 8189)
  • Adjustable slide rails provide 8.3" fore/aft adjustment
  • Set slides at 11.25" W or 12.91" W
  • Weight indicator with adjustment of 100 - 375 lbs
  • Accepts operator presence switch (standard on PNs: 7916, 7776, 7882 & 8189) (optional on PNs: 8188 & 8462)

Complies with FEM 4.002 (for forklift trucks) and ISO 6683 (for earth-moving equipment).

Fits Caterpillar® Skid Steers: 246C, 256C, 262C, 272C, 277C, 287C, 289C, 297C, 299C
